Summary
China's oil refining industry emitted nearly 4 billion tons of greenhouse gases from 2000-2020. Targeting major deep-conversion and ultra-high emission refineries with specific strategies is key for decarbonization.

Bioremediation
22.0K
Bioremediation is the use of prokaryotes, fungi, or plants to remove pollutants from the environment. This process has been used to remove harmful toxins in groundwater as a byproduct of agricultural run-off and also to clean up oil spills.

Turnover Number and Catalytic Efficiency
19.9K
The turnover number of an enzyme is the maximum number of substrate molecules it can transform per unit time. Turnover numbers for most enzymes range from 1 to 1000 molecules per second. Catalase has the known highest turnover number, capable of converting up to 2.8×106 molecules of hydrogen peroxide into water and oxygen per second. Lysozyme has the lowest known turnover number of half a molecule per second.
